The IFMA awards gala awarded nominees in many different categories. The nominees in the category of Best TV Show included The Contender Asia, The Challenger Muaythai, WMC Muaythai Warriors, The Silk Road Cup and Challenger Elite. Presenting the award on the evening was H.E. Giberto Fonseca Guimarães de Moura, Ambassador of Brazil to Thailand.

The growth and development of sport not only lies in the building of athletes, teams and officials. Through television and digital media the sport of muaythai has been popularised around the world. Reality shows have allowed the fans to experience the daily struggles, victories and defeats of muaythai athletes while broadcast of live events have brought the electrifying atmosphere of stadiums into the living rooms of millions of households.

The winner of the 2015 IFMA Awards Best TV Show was announced as The Challenger Muaythai and the show’s host and mentor Stephan Fox accepted the award stating that the award truly belonged to the show’s contestants whom shared their weekly journey; their dreams hopes and sacrifices with viewers. He said it was this that made the show such a success. He especially thanked Mr Riaz Mehta founder and CEO of Imagine OmniMedia (IOM), Dato Shahnaz Azmi, President of the Malaysian Muaythai Association for the show’s creation and production; and Tourism Selangor and Selangor State Government, especially YB Elizabeth Wong for their unwavering support.
